My takes:

Interesting first round picks--pex grabbing Dr J before Artis or McAdoo was interesting. Not saying it is a bad pick in any way. Just seems like both big men might be more valuable in this format, and usually get drafted either around the same time as Erving in DH555's $52 mill league. But pex is DA MAN and usually makes better decisions than I do, so I am NOT criticizing it at all. Just found it interesting.

BOTH of skypilots 1st round picks seemed like a bit of a reach to me. Barnes has great numbers, as does Parish, but it seems like historically, they are both later 1st round picks or even 2nd rounders. Then again, if 6544 REALLY liked both, I doubt either would be there for him on the way back in round 2.

I know from past drafts that smokey has a pretty strong case of "man love" for George McGiness, but I would be surprised if he could NOT have gotten him in round 2 or maybe even round 3, because of the turnovers and fairly low eFG for his usage.

Bill Walton is a tough call in any league. He only plays about 2300 minutes in his best season, but when he does play, he has some MONSTER #'s. Still, I had the 10th pick and would not have even considered Big Red with that pick, but he went one before to Uofa2. I have drafted Walton before and he is very frustrating to be sure. Having Walton on your team is kinda like when you are 7 or 8 years old, and you get a nice big ice cream cone, and you take about ten-20 licks and then it falls off the cone and onto the pavement. Just enough of a taste to know how good it is, but always ending up wanting more.

My final thought is about Norm Nixon. I always liked Norm Nixon. Good eFG, a few assists, decent defense. But I think he is overvalued in the 1st round. Nice player, but so many better options out there IMO. We'll see if Navy can make up for it with his hext few picks.

I took a long look at Artis, but in the end I wanted Dr. J so I don't have to worry as much about usage later. Also, Dr J has a higher WAR at SG than Artis has at C. He's just so much better than the next available SG. But Artis was easily the next pick.

I think Walton is a good call since the limited minutes he does bring are quality. I try to draft quality over quantity because I can get quantity at any point in the draft.

I thought the absolute steals of the draft so far are Bob Lanier at 14 to gerry and Bobby Jones at 21 to bds. It couldn't have taken gerry more than 2 seconds to pick Lanier. If they follow those up with good 2nd round picks they are going to be strong contenders.

More established than successful, but I'll say this. O is a nice 1st pick from your spot in the draft but would go with the 61-2 or 62-3 season. I think you have the right Barry. Don't understand the Hillman pick. D obviously great but not enough usage up front and barely enough on the team (12 usg points). Need more offense at center and Bridges, a nice defender and rebounder, can cover for whatever D he lacks. Shelton has good efg% but he's a foul machine. I see what you're trying to do on D but I think it's costing you in too many other areas. The good news. Still plenty of players out there to continue to build.
